summary refs log tree commit diff
diff options
context:
space:
mode:
authorMarkus S. Wamser <github-dev@mail2013.wamser.eu>2020-05-10 22:04:39 +0200
committerMarkus S. Wamser <github-dev@mail2013.wamser.eu>2020-05-10 22:54:17 +0200
commitf5c0535213267164bf26145cfefb94f5ed58c38e (patch)
treeb829ad2714f4bb3c801d9ffcac657f761e271985
parentae4d9cb9a0bc242ec587a756c53fdacddae1ef45 (diff)
downloadnixpkgs-f5c0535213267164bf26145cfefb94f5ed58c38e.tar
nixpkgs-f5c0535213267164bf26145cfefb94f5ed58c38e.tar.gz
nixpkgs-f5c0535213267164bf26145cfefb94f5ed58c38e.tar.bz2
nixpkgs-f5c0535213267164bf26145cfefb94f5ed58c38e.tar.lz
nixpkgs-f5c0535213267164bf26145cfefb94f5ed58c38e.tar.xz
nixpkgs-f5c0535213267164bf26145cfefb94f5ed58c38e.tar.zst
nixpkgs-f5c0535213267164bf26145cfefb94f5ed58c38e.zip
libfm: fix duplicate inclusion of libfm-extra
-rw-r--r--pkgs/development/libraries/libfm/default.nix5
1 files changed, 5 insertions, 0 deletions
diff --git a/pkgs/development/libraries/libfm/default.nix b/pkgs/development/libraries/libfm/default.nix
index 9145d8fd892..94476984de0 100644
--- a/pkgs/development/libraries/libfm/default.nix
+++ b/pkgs/development/libraries/libfm/default.nix
@@ -28,6 +28,11 @@ stdenv.mkDerivation rec {
     "sysconfdir=${placeholder "out"}/etc"
   ];
 
+  # libfm-extra is pulled in by menu-cache and thus leads to a collision for libfm
+  postInstall = optional (!extraOnly) ''
+     rm $out/lib/libfm-extra.so $out/lib/libfm-extra.so.* $out/lib/libfm-extra.la $out/lib/pkgconfig/libfm-extra.pc
+  '';
+
   enableParallelBuilding = true;
 
   meta = with stdenv.lib; {